4548565452798
Showing the single result
-
Kyosho
Kyosho One Piece Clutch Bell (0.8M/17T/Light Weight) Part # 97058LW-17
Original price was: $31.99.$28.99Current price is: $28.99.
SEARCH ALL ABOVE
PICK A BRAND BELOW
Showing the single result
FREE SHIPPING OVER $100 U.S. Orders Only. Dismiss